/* Namco System FL Driver by R. Belmont and ElSemi IMPORTANT --------- To calibrate the steering, do the following: 1) Delete the .nv file 2) Start the game. Speed Racer will guide you through the calibration (the "jump button" is the same as player 1 start). For Final Lap R, hold down service (9) and tap test (F2). If you do not get an "initializing" message followed by the input test, keep doing it until you do. 3) Exit MAME and restart the game, it's now calibrated.
